Default rendering for ipod video

i just got a new ipod video which im kind of a newb with. anyways i wanted to put some of my videos on it. i've been rendering to the mp4 format with its default template, but when its all done it doesn't want to transfer onto my ipod. oh and i have vegas 6.0c.

am i doing something wrong or is vegas just not capable of doing this?
